Witam w moim drugim skrypcie!
Jest to skrypt MrKits, czyli skrypt na kity.
Ok może krótko o skrypcie. Skrypt jest napisany w ciągłych liniach rozciągających się na 70 wierszy, sam skrypt może do napisania nie jest łatwy (szczególnie dla nowych osób), ale krok po kroku wytłumaczę na czym polega argument, dawanie przedmiotów itp.
command /mrkits [<text>] [<text>]: <--- Rozpoczęcie naszego skryptu z argumentami. Są potrzebne, by nie robić milion osobnych komend.
permission: use.mrkits <----- To jest permisja potrzebna do całego skryptu
permission message: &cBrak uprawnien <----- Jest to wyświetlana wiadomość kiedy nie mamy uprawnień do użycia tej komendy.
trigger: <---- Bez tego napisu nasz skrypt by nie działał.
if arg 1 is not set: <---- Jeżeli argument nie jest wypełniony to wyświetli nam pomoc.
send "&6&lMrKits&8&l>>&cPoprawne uzycie /mrkits help/pomoc"
if arg 1 is "help" or "pomoc": <--- Gdy wpiszemy /mrkits help lub pomoc, dalsza czesc kodu zostanie zrealizowana.
send "&6----------[&bMrKits&6]----------"
send "&a/mrkits give [kit name] - Daje nam wybrany kit"
send "&a/mrkits list - Pokazuje liste kitow"
send "&a/mrkits autor - Tworca skryptu"
send "&6----------[&bMrKits&6]----------"
if arg 1 is "give": <--- Jest to nasze uzupelnienie komendy, czyli "give"
if arg 2 is not set: <--- Tak jak pisałem wcześniej jeżeli nie wypełnimy argumentu to po prostu wyświetli się nam komunikat
send "&6&lMrKits&8&l>>&cPoprawne uzycie /mrkits give [nazwa kitu]"
if arg 2 is "Startowy": <---- To jest drugie wypelnienie argumentu.
set {czasstartowy} to difference between {opoznieniestartowy.%player%} and now <--- 3 linijki, które odliczają czas do ponownego użycia.
if {czasstartowy} is less than 3600 seconds:
send "&6&lMrKits&8&l>>&cPrzykro mi, ponownie mozesz uzyc Kit Startowy za %difference between 3600 seconds and {czasstartowy}%"
else: <--- Jeżeli nasz czas wynosi 0 seconds, to dostaniemy nasz kit startowy.
give 1 stone sword named "&aStartowy Miecz" to player
give 1 stone pickaxe named "&aStartowy Kilof" to player
give 1 stone axe named "&aStartowa Siekiera" to player
give 1 stone shovel named "&aStartowa Lopata" to player
give 1 leather helmet named "&aStartowy Helm" to player
give 1 leather chestplate named "&aStartowa Zbroja" to player
give 1 leather leggings named "&aStartowe Nogawice" to player
give 1 leather boots named "&aStartowe Buty" to player
set {opoznieniestartowy.%player%} to now
Pełny kod: https://code.skript.pl/w0KEBHtu